Narendra Kawde, Member—This consumer complaint has been filed by the complainant alleging deficiency in service against the opponent, Raj Homes S.V. Builders and ors. (hereinafter referred to as “opponent builder/developer”) since the opponent builder/developer did not deliver possession of the flat as per the provisions of registered sale deed. Case in brief as pleaded by the complainant is summarized as under :

2. The complainant has entered into the agreement dated 21/01/2010 with the opponent builder/developer for purchase of flat no.601 on the 6th floor in ‘A’ Wing admeasuring 1033 sq.ft. at the agreed consideration of Rs. 65,14,400/- As per the agreement, construction of the flat was to be completed and the flat was to be handed after it is ready for use i.e. on or before 31st August, 2010. However, the opponent builder/developer failed to act as per the provisions of the agreement entered between the parties of the flat in stipulated time. The complainant for several times approached the opponent builder/developer for delivery of possession of the flat and subsequently issued notice through the advocate.
